Tim Stimpson is to leave Leicester for Perpignan earlier than expected. He needs to register with the French club by next week so that he can qualify to play in the Heineken Cup.
Stimpson, who has not played for a month because of a knee injury, will bid farewell before Saturday's game against Wasps.
"I'd like to thank everybody associated with Tigers for the tremendous support they've given me over the last five-and-a-half years," he said.
Director of rugby Dean Richards added: "We'll be sad to see him go, but life goes on, and this was too good an opportunity for him to miss.
"Tim is leaving a couple of weeks earlier than expected as Heineken Cup rules mean he has to be registered for them by next week.
"It's a shame that his knee injury has kept him from playing for the last few weeks - I'm sure he would have liked to have gone out on a high in front of the Welford Road crowd."
